This is the Coast Guard Cutter "Alert" which is a twin to the "The Steadfast". These ships are routinely docked at the 17th street pier in Astoria when they need to be re-supplied.

This image forms part of the digitised photographs of the Ross and Pat Craig Collection. Ross Craig (1926-2012) was a local historian born in Stockton and dedicated much of his life promoting and conserving the history of Stockton, NSW. He possessed a wealth of knowledge about the suburb and was a founding member of the Stockton Historical Society and co-editor of its magazine. Pat Craig supported her husband’s passion for history, and together they made a great contribution to the Stockton and Newcastle communities. Honolulu HI - On February 12, 2020 U.S. Coast Guard Sector Honolulu put on a Command and Control demonstration for government officials from Democratic Republic of Timor-Leste. The demonstration incorporated the use of a Coast Guard Sector Honolulu patrol boat (cutter Kittiwake), a Station Honolulu response boat, and both a Coast Guard Auxiliary utility boat and aircraft. The purpose of the exercise was to show how how a target of interest could be intercepted in the offshore waters near Oahu, Hawaii. All photos by Kevin Cooper
